	<abstract><![CDATA[<p>It has been more than a decade since America Online dominated headlines as the future of media. Oh how times have changed! AOL rose from a company that originally made video games to a paper-behemoth that managed to purchase Time Warner in 2001. After a long series of disappointments AOL announced on Thursday that it would be separating from Time Warner. </p>
